[Source] The skin of goats or sheep from the Bovine family. 【Original form】For details about the animal form, please refer to the entry for "mutton". 【Chemical composition】 Contains water, protein, fat and inorganic substances, with the latter two in very small amounts. The proteins that make up the epidermis are mainly keratin, while those that make up the dermis are mainly collagen and reticulin. In addition, it also contains elastin, albumin, globulin and mucin. The epidermis often contains melanin, which is a metabolite of tyrosine. Reticulin is the main protein that makes up the reticular tissue, and it and collagen make up most of the skin. The fat content of goat skin is similar to that of other animals (such as cattle), but the fat content of sheep skin is particularly high. 【Functions and indications】 ① "Dietary Therapy Materia Medica": "Remove the hair and cook it into soup: it can replenish the body.
